Make sense of now: in the swirl of changes in science, technology, the media, politics, and ideologies, spot the historical trends in international relations and shape your own professional future.
Get a fix on the past, and help shape the future: take a multi-disciplinary, globally oriented approach to political, social, and economic trends. Sharpen your analytical and critical skills, and get the tools you need to do cutting-edge research with literature and original sources. Intern in museums, archives, or other institutions, or do fieldwork in non-Western societies, and get a start on a policy-oriented career in government, business, the media, or education, or on an academic career. Erasmus is a top-ranked institution in an international, forward-looking, multi-cultural city. The programme is taught by renowned faculty who give you the individual attention you need as you contribute to our understanding of a fast-changing world.

This programme has a workload of 60 ECTS.
You are normally required to take an English Proficiency Test if you come from a non-English speaking country.
Most European Universities recognise the IELTS test.
More informationPrevious education: BA/BSc.
Additional language requirements:
| IELTS Band: | 7.0 |
| Cambridge English: Advanced (CAE): | Grade B (Score: 75) |
| TOEFL Paper-based: | 600 |
| TOEFL Computer-based: | 250 |
| TOEFL Internet-based: | 100 |
Accredited by: NVAO in: Netherlands
